1 Rating:

Nasa STS 80 UFOs


  • Yendor65#

    Yendor65 July 20, 2010 9:47:08 AM CEST

    Absolutely by far some of the most compeling evidence of intellegent ET's there is! This footage has been out for awhile but in my opinion some of the best hard proof we got.

  • Biff1#

    Biff1 July 19, 2010 11:11:48 PM CEST

    if they are only doing this when its cloudy how we supposed 2 see the things why aint they jus come down now 4### SAKE boring i want to drive a ufo yo alien give me ago !!

Visit Disclose.tv on Facebook